1 leg squats, yes the one leg is going to get stronger, however your other leg will quickly catch up once you can work out with it again. You'll be stronger by the end.
If you practice handstand push ups now and are capable of doing them, then I would. If you don't have a handstand then I would not recommend it. When you first start off you can have some pretty hard landings, and if your doing it alone with one foot ideally, it has trouble written all over it. |
